The ants trailing across your counter are foragers searching for food, and the nest can be anywhere from inside the walls to under the yard. Our technicians trace them back to the source and apply bait that workers carry into the colony to wipe out the queen.

  • Forager Trail Tracing — Track active trails back to the nest or satellite colony before placing any bait.
  • Transfer Bait Placement — Position slow-acting bait that foragers carry back to eliminate workers and the queen.
  • Structural Gap Closure — Close confirmed entry points to reduce the likelihood of new ant activity in the same areas.

Flea Control

Flea eggs in your carpet and larvae in floor gaps keep hatching for weeks even after the pet is treated, because the infestation lives in the home not just on the animal. We cover all life stages indoors and outdoors in a single visit to break the cycle completely.

  • Full Life-Cycle Treatment — Use adulticide and IGR together to target every flea life stage simultaneously.
  • Egg Zone Concentration — Focus treatment on the surfaces where flea eggs are most likely to accumulate and hatch.
  • Post-Hatch Return Visit — Schedule a return after the hatching cycle to assess adult emergence and treat any remaining activity.

Fly Control

Drain flies breed in pipe buildup, fruit flies breed in overripe produce, and house flies breed in garbage and organic waste, so basic sprays that kill adults do nothing to stop the next wave. We identify the exact breeding source and eliminate it directly.

  • Breeding Source Location — Find the organic matter, moisture, or drain buildup where flies are laying eggs.
  • Larval Source Removal — Treat or eliminate the conditions where fly larvae are developing before adults emerge.
  • Access Gap Identification — Identify the gaps, cracks, and openings flies are using to move from outside into the structure.

Silverfish Control

Silverfish chew through book bindings, wallpaper, and natural-fiber fabrics because they feed on starch and cellulose found in those materials. We locate the active population in your damp wall voids and storage areas and treat both the harborage and the food source zones.

  • Feeding Damage Inspection — Locate chewed paper, fabric damage, and irregular holes to map where silverfish are most active.
  • Vulnerable Item Storage Advice — Advise on sealed storage containers for paper, books, and natural-fiber fabrics at risk of damage.
  • Complete Harborage Application — Treat every dark, humid zone - bathrooms, wall voids, and storage areas - where silverfish shelter.
